NY Democrats Eye 2020 Presidential Bid

Manatt’s Bruce Gyory, a senior advisor in the firm’s government and regulatory practice, was quoted by NY State of Politics for an article on New Yorkers who are looking toward the 2020 presidential election.
 
While the current president is the first New Yorker to sit in the White House in more than 60 years, the publication explained that in 2020, three New York Democrats may be vying for the nomination—Governor Andrew Cuomo, New York City Mayor Bill de Blasio and Senator Kirsten Gillibrand.
 
“We have a very diverse state so you have to prove, if you’re a New Yorker, that you can carry not just a huge metropolis in New York City but the suburbs and not get blown out in the rural areas,” Gyory explained.
 
He mentioned that de Blasio, fresh off his successful re-election bid, is planning to travel to Iowa, the state that hosts the first-in-the-nation caucus, while Cuomo and Gillibrand have a statewide standing that could also help.
 
“In Governor Cuomo and Senator Gillibrand, we have two very accomplished political figures who are proven both good at governing and commanding public attention,” Gyory said.
